SUMMARY

Retrograde intrarenal surgery is commonly performed under general anesthesia for the treatment of renal stones. During the procedure, respiratory-related renal movement caused by positive-pressure ventilation may impair endoscopic image stability and reduce the efficiency of laser lithotripsy. This randomized controlled trial aims to compare the effects of normal ventilation and low tidal volume ventilation on intraoperative endoscopic image stability during RIRS using a video-based Motion Index. Eligible adult patients scheduled for elective RIRS under general anesthesia will be randomized in a 1:1 ratio to either normal tidal volume ventilation or low tidal volume ventilation. A standardized 60-second intraoperative video segment in which the stone and/or active laser lithotripsy is visible will be analyzed by blinded assessors. The primary outcome is the mean Motion Index value calculated from sequential video frames. Secondary outcomes include additional Motion Index parameters, laser activation time, anesthesia and surgical duration, intraoperative respiratory and hemodynamic safety parameters, vasopressor requirement, complications, and stone-free status at routine follow-up.

Treatments
Active_comparator: Normal Tidal Volume Ventilation
Participants in this group will receive standard mechanical ventilation after induction of general anesthesia and endotracheal intubation during retrograde intrarenal surgery. Tidal volume will be set at 6-8 mL/kg predicted body weight with 5 cmH₂O PEEP. Respiratory rate will be titrated to maintain EtCO₂ between 35 and 45 mmHg, and FiO₂ will be adjusted to maintain SpO₂ above 94%.
Experimental: Low Tidal Volume Ventilation
Participants in this group will receive low tidal volume mechanical ventilation after induction of general anesthesia and endotracheal intubation during retrograde intrarenal surgery. Tidal volume will be set at 4-6 mL/kg predicted body weight with 5 cmH₂O PEEP. Respiratory rate will be titrated to maintain EtCO₂ between 35 and 45 mmHg, and FiO₂ will be adjusted to maintain SpO₂ above 94%.
